Grand Opening held for Harbaugh Seaside Trails
Nature Collective, the nonprofit that stewards lands such as San Elijo Lagoon, held the grand opening of Harbaugh Seaside Trails Feb. 22. The event honored many supporters, including The Harbaugh Foundation. Collectively, every donation helped Nature Collective save stunning and uninterrupted coastal views from development.
Harbaugh Seaside Trails is the three-acre coastal overlook, designated permanent open space for all, linking Cardiff-by-the-Sea and Solana Beach along historic Coast Highway 101.
“The grand opening of Harbaugh Seaside Trails is a long-awaited milestone rooted in community spirit,” says Doug Gibson, Nature Collective executive director. “So many people collectively worked together with us to save these views in a symbol of love for community and nature for generations.”
During the ceremony, hundreds of guests had the opportunity to tour the new trail for the first time. Native plants were installed on the property by community volunteers this past fall. The donor monument carries through the Coastal Rail Trail mosaic art theme with depictions of lagoon life embedded in handmade tiles. The shell-shaped viewing deck offers sunset watching and peaceful contemplation in nature.
A time capsule was dedicated by community leaders—to be reopened in 2050.
